Processing Sugar Mill Waste: Complete Filter Mud Fertilizer Granulation Production Line Guide

2026-05-13
Latest company news about Processing Sugar Mill Waste: Complete Filter Mud Fertilizer Granulation Production Line Guide

Sugar mills generate vast quantities of filter mud (press mud), a nutrient-rich byproduct that is often underutilized. However, with the right filter mud fertilizer line, this industrial waste can be transformed into high-value organic granules. Utilizing a combination of double roller extrusion granulation and spherical polishing technology, manufacturers can produce dense, uniform, and highly marketable organic fertilizers.

This guide explores the technical workflow of sugar mill waste processing and how to achieve premium results using advanced machinery.


Why Convert Filter Mud into Organic Fertilizer?

Filter mud is packed with organic matter, nitrogen, phosphorus, and essential micronutrients. Implementing a dedicated organic fertilizer from filter mud strategy offers significant advantages:

Waste Valorization: Turns a disposal headache into a secondary revenue stream for sugar mills.

Soil Amendment: Provides a slow-release nutrient source that improves soil structure and water retention.

Environmental Compliance: Reduces the environmental footprint of sugar mill waste processing by eliminating landfilling.


The Core Technology: Extrusion Granulation + Pellet Polishing

To produce professional-grade fertilizer, the filter mud fertilizer line must solve the challenge of the material's physical consistency. Our solution utilizes a two-step shaping process:

1. Double Roller Extrusion Granulation
The double roller extrusion granulator is the heart of this line. Unlike wet granulation methods, extrusion works at room temperature using dry-press technology.

High Density: The intense mechanical pressure creates exceptionally dense pellets that are resistant to crumbling during transport.

No Binder Required: The natural properties of filter mud allow for strong bonding under pressure, reducing the cost of chemical additives.

2. Particle Polishing Machine (Spherical Shaper)
While extrusion produces cylindrical "pills," the market often prefers spherical granules.

Aesthetic & Functional Upgrade: The pellet polishing machine rounds off the edges of the extruded pellets.

Uniformity: This process ensures a consistent particle size, which is critical for automated field application and improves the final "premium" look of the organic fertilizer from filter mud.


Step-by-Step Filter Mud Fertilizer Production Process

A complete filter mud fertilizer line integrates several stages to ensure a stable and high-quality output:

Fermentation & Dehydration: Raw filter mud is fermented to stabilize organic matter. Since extrusion requires specific moisture levels, the material is dried to approximately 5%–10% moisture.

Crushing & Mixing: A vertical crusher breaks down any clumps, and a horizontal mixer incorporates additional nutrients (like NPK) if a compound fertilizer is desired.

Extrusion Granulation: The prepared mix is fed into the double roller granulator, forming solid shapes.

Polishing: The pellets enter the polishing machine, where high-speed rotation creates the desired spherical finish.

Screening & Packaging: A rotary screen separates fine dust, which is recycled back into the granulator, ensuring a zero-waste sugar mill waste processing cycle.
